Notes
Close-up shows the conspicuous bivalved, unstalked pedicellariae (mini-pincers). Recent DNA work has shown that H. spinosa is the same as Hippasteria phrygiana. The latter takes precidence as it is the older name. Reference: Foltz, D.W. et.al. 2013. Global population divergence of the sea star Hippasteria phrygiana corresponds to the onset of the last glacial period of the Pleistocene. Marine Biology (2013): 1-12.
